1. INTRODUCTION
This report details with the result of Vertical initial pile load test (in compression) conducted
on a Test pile (P-5) to access the safe load carrying capacity of pile provided for the proposed
Construction of “70 TPD Air Separation Plant” at KMML, Chavara, Kollam District. The test is
conducted as per IS 2911 (Part IV)-2013 and the observations are noted in the standard data format.

5. DETAILS OF KENTLEDGE
As per IS 2911 – Part IV the Total kentledge load required for conducting the load test is 25%
extra of test load.
Kentledge Required = 1.25 * (Test Load)
= 1.25 * (1.5 * Design Load)
= 1.25 * 1.5 * 80
= 150 M.T

7. LOAD TEST SETUP
A platform of 6.5 m X 6.0 m and 2.5 m height is made by placing Main girder of ISMB
400 Sections and ISMB 300 as secondary girder above them in the perpendicular direction. Kent
ledge is filled with sand bag and placed all around. The test Pile head was made smooth and leveled
with POP. A bearing plate was placed on the head of pile for the jack to rest. Loads were applied by
means of hydraulic jack, reacting against a loaded platform. Hydraulic jack was placed l on the test
pile and the gap is filled in between the jack and the main girder by placing suitable steel packing.
Load applied is with a 300 MT capacity Hydraulic jack and is applied as recommended. Four dial
gauges of 0.01 mm least count placed 90 degree angles to each other on a plate placed over the pile
but below the jack, and the needle of the dial gauge is placed over a platform coming downwards
from the datum bars placed 2.00 m away from the face of the pile with strong concrete.

Total load applied is 122.13 Metric Tones and the Total settlement is 3.500 mm. Rebound
observed while releasing the load is 1.977 mm. There for the net settlement during this pile load test
is 1.522 mm. Which is well within the limits prescribed by the IS Code 2911(Part 4) 2013. Hence
the pile is safe for, design load of 80 Metric Tons.
